THANE: The Special Investigation Team (SIT) is investigating the Case of sexual assault by two kindergarten students in Badlapur has found important evidence in connection with the case. The SIT has found CCTV footage the main gate of the school, with the accused Entering and leaving the school on August 12 and 13. This footage confirms the defendant's presence at the school on the day of the crime.
One can remember that the Video surveillance Footage of the nursery section of the school where the crime involving the girls took place was blocked for 15 days before the incident. This raised questions about the school administration. However, the SIT team found that the CCTV cameras in the rest of the school, especially the main gate. The SIT team examined as evidence the CCTV footage showing the accused entering and leaving the school premises on the two main days of the incident.
On the other hand, the SIT filed a separate First Information Report (FIR) on the incident involving the first victim on August 25, a day before the accused was sent to jail. In the FIR, the victim stated that the accused sexually abused her while carrying a stick in the toilet. The victim also mentioned that she informed her parents about the incident, who later approached the school on August 13 to report the incident. However, the school did not take any action nor did it inform the local police.
SIT sources said that the local police, which filed the first FIR based on the parents of the second victim, who approached the police directly, mentioned the sexual abuse of the first victim. To have a watertight case in this matter, we have filed a separate FIR regarding the first victim. Meanwhile, the SIT team on Wednesday recorded the statements of some other school teachers from the nursery section in the case.
MNS chief Raj Thackeray meets protesters and parents from Badlapur
MNS chief Raj Thackeray visited Badlapur on Wednesday where he met parents of the school as well as protesters from Badlapur town who participated in the violent protests at the school and the Rail Roko at Badlapur railway station to protest against the Badlapur sexual assault case. During the visit, Raj Thackeray collected information from the parents about the entire incident.
Meanwhile, protesters complained that the railway police were visiting the houses of protesters at midnight to take action against them and harassing those who were not involved in the protests. Raj Thackeray then spoke to Railway Police Commissioner Ravindra Shishve over the phone and directed him to ensure that such incidents do not occur again.
